Overview
This iconic road trip will take you down the California coast on the windy and beautiful Pacific Coast Highway. Kick off your trip in San Francisco and pick up your RV before heading south. Make your first stop on the coast in Monterey, where you can marvel at the many species at the Monterey Bay Aquarium. Continue your drive to Big Sur, home to secluded beaches, giant redwoods, and a laid-back vibe. The road takes you to Morro Bay before you hit Santa Barbara, also known as the “American Riviera”, where you can relax on the beach or stroll through this adorable beach town. Your last stop brings you to Ventura, a surfer town with charming shops and restaurants, and also a great jumping off point for the Channel Islands. Finish your adventure in sunny Los Angeles before returning home.
California Coastline Suggested RV Itinerary*
San Francisco - 1 night
You’ll be welcomed to California by the City by the Bay with the infamous fog and popular destinations like Fisherman’s Wharf, Pier 39, Lombard Street and Telegraph Hill.
Monterey - 2 nights
Known best for the Monterey Bay Aquarium, everyone will love marveling at these sea creatures. Take a whale watching tour and fall asleep to the sound of waves crashing on the beach.
Big Sur - 2 nights
Secluded beaches and unspoiled rock formations line this section of the coast. Explore this peaceful town and find your secret spot on Pfieffer Beach.
Morro Bay - 1 night
A quiet town on the coast, take in the smell of the ocean and relax on the beach.
Santa Barbara - 2 nights
Explore this charming, ritzy, beach town with its Spanish architecture and bouganvillas. Take a walk through the stunning harbor, wander the many shops, and dip your toes in the ocean.
Ventura - 2 nights
Spend the day on the beach or learn to surf. This is a surfing town, after all. Take a ferry to Channel Islands National Park to see a different side of southern California.
End in the City of Angels to return your RV and head home.
*Route can also be reversed to start in Los Angeles and end in San Francisco
